CVE-2012-6314: Medium severity citrix virtual apps and desktops vulnerability
Published Dec 26, 2012
·Updated
Citrix XenDesktop Virtual Desktop Agent (VDA) 5.6.x before 5.6.200, when making changes to the server-side policy that control USB redirection, does not propagate changes to the VDA, which allows authenticated users to retain access to the USB device.

What is the severity of CVE-2012-6314?
CVE-2012-6314 has a medium severity level due to potential unauthorized access to USB devices.
2
How do I fix CVE-2012-6314?
To fix CVE-2012-6314, update the Citrix XenDesktop Virtual Desktop Agent to version 5.6.200 or later.
3
Who is affected by CVE-2012-6314?
CVE-2012-6314 affects users of Citrix XenDesktop Virtual Desktop Agent version 5.6.x prior to 5.6.200.
4
What is the impact of CVE-2012-6314?
The impact of CVE-2012-6314 is that authenticated users may improperly access USB devices without proper server-side policy enforcement.
